Micky van de Ven put Tottenham ahead at Turf Moor in the first half, but his opener was canceled out by Axel Tuanzebe in stoppage time.
Lyle Foster gave the Clarets the lead with 15 minutes remaining and put them within reach of a much-needed win, but Cristian Romero equalized late on to ensure the Lilywhites went home with a point.
Xavi Simons makes ‘unacceptable’ Spurs admission after draw against Burnley
“We wanted to win and the two goals we conceded are not acceptable,” Simons told Premier League Productions. “It’s a shame, but we have to move on.
“In general, yes [we deserved to win]but here you have to win – even if the goalkeeper has a great game. We have to score those goals and we have to win.”
He continued: “We can’t stop this goal a minute before half-time and neither can we stop the second goal, I think we can avoid it.”
As Spurs fought back to earn a draw, Simons added: “We know how good we are with set pieces and crosses, and the two centre-backs Micky and Cristian are good there. Really good.”
“The only solution is to keep working. That’s how we do it.”
